People are posting joke responses because this is one of, if not *the*, most famous and iconic synths of all time - the MiniMoog.
This is the synth that essentially popularised the synth as a concept in the 1970’s. Before that they were big bulky things the size of fridges, but Robert Moog put that tech into a much smaller enclosure and put a keyboard on it, which led to it being embraced by rock, jazz and pop artists. All the big bands in the 70’s used these and without the MiniMoog the synth world would be completely different.
